    Guys there is no current way to get a 2.1 SLIC in 99% of Dell computers with 2.0 SLIC (machines that came with Vista).

    If you read the thread, some people are working on it, but there are technical limitations currently preventing replacing SLIC 2.0 with 2.1 for now.

    I am as anxious as anyone--especially now that an OEMSLP key is available, but those of us with Dells with 2.0 SLIC are stuck for now (and maybe forever).

    You will have to use soft mod.
